Claims (1)

Способ рафинирования свинца от примесей сурьмы, олова и мышьяка, включающий предварительную очистку состоящую в введении в расплав свинца алюминия при температуре не превышающей 680÷750°С, перемешивании, отстаивании и последующей доочистки, отличающийся тем, что последующую доочистку до получения свинца не ниже марки СО осуществляют вначале охлаждением расплава со скоростью не более 10 град·мин-1 до температуры 350°С с удалением твердых съемов, а затем - анодной поляризацией в гидроксиде натрия при температуре 360÷380°С с продолжительностью не более 2 ч.The method of refining lead from impurities of antimony, tin and arsenic, including preliminary cleaning consisting of introducing aluminum into the lead melt at a temperature not exceeding 680 ÷ 750 ° C, stirring, settling and subsequent post-treatment, characterized in that the subsequent post-treatment to obtain lead is not lower than grade SB is performed initially by cooling the melt at a rate not exceeding 10 degrees min -1 to a temperature of 350 ° C with removal of solid detachably and then - anodic polarization in sodium hydroxide at a temperature of 360 ÷ 380 ° C with a duration of n over 2 hours.
